WebThe Philippines, ruled first from Mexico City and later from Madrid, was a Spanish territory for 333 years (1565–1898). [19] Schooling was a priority, however. The Augustinians opened a school immediately upon arriving in Cebú in 1565. The Franciscans followed suit when they arrived in 1577, as did the Dominicans when they arrived in 1587. WebSpanish colonialism was simultaneously being weakened by revolts in Cuba and the Philippines, its largest remaining colonies. The Philippine Revolution of 1896 to 1897 destabilized Spanish colonialism but failed to remove Spanish colonial rule. The leaders of the revolution were exiled to Hong Kong.
